Summary: Who are we, and how have we become so?  What combination of demography, geography, human interaction, opportunity and innate character have convolved to create us, and how is that nature now manifest?  I contend that habits and routines offer the most loyal definition of one's current state. And only when habits are broken and routines interrupted can we introspect meaningfully and choose a new pattern. On today's episode, we go back to where it all began for me: Rosedale Park, NJ. With a simple misty morning walk, I begin a new, postoperative routine with a simple, though ambitious, goal. I aim to hike every single day in April and reclaim the obstinate passion previously displayed in 300+ day climbing years now denied to my temporarily gimpy body.
